Runbook: Scanline barcode bridge

If warehouse scans stop flowing into Cartwheel, it's almost always the bridge service on the Dunmore floor box wedging after a USB hiccup. Bounce the service first — nine times out of ten that fixes it. If not, check the queue depth before escalating. When restarting, make sure the bridge comes up with these settings.

deployment values, yafop-bajef:
[gilok]
team = ulaius
access_code = ac_423664
host = gilok.sivrelhq.corp
port = 9200
owner = pelius.istax
peer = eliok.torvasoft.internal

Subject: Bulk-edit cut-over complete

Hi — welcome aboard. Over the weekend we moved the Ostervale admin table from per-row saves to batched bulk edits. Batches commit transactionally, so a single bad row now rolls back the whole edit; the UI surfaces which row failed. Audit logging is unchanged. Please read the validation notes before touching selectors. The production service currently runs with the following configuration.

service settings:
[casax]
port = 6379
team = rusir
host = casax.zemvarhq.corp
region = outer-4
access_code = ac_9808ce
timeout_ms = 1500

This summary covers the proposed 12% price increase for legacy customers on the Ostrel platform. Roughly 1,900 accounts remain on pre-2021 terms, contributing 18% of recurring revenue at margins well below current plans. Modelling suggests churn of 6–9% at the proposed increase, leaving net revenue up approximately 8% in year one. Notice letters are drafted and legal has confirmed the contracts permit the change with sixty days' warning. The broader strategic context is noted below.

confidential, kagup-bafog: Fraaxax Group is in early talks to buy Soroxox Group for about $343.8 million. The Olidor launch date is June 14, and nothing goes to the press before then. Legal wants the Aldmirek Logistics term sheet signed before July 23.